- To find a name on FamilySearch, you can follow these steps12:
- Go to the FamilySearch Catalog.
- Click Places to close the Places Search.
- Click Surnames to open it.
- Type a surname.
- Click Search.
- Click a title to see more details. The record may be a book, a microfilm, or digitized on the Internet.
